Andrew Lang (31 March 1844 – 20 July 1912) is well-known as a collector of British folk and fairy tales, but he was a Victorian poet, novelist, academic and critic too. His poem had success, but he became famous published Andrew Lang's Fairy Books of Many Colors – series of twelve different colored collections of fairy tales books (1889-1910). It includes 437 tales from different countries and different cultures. 
The Story of Bensurdatu is a fairy tale from the Sicilianische Märchen published by Andrew Lang in The Grey Fairy Book in 1900. The king and the queen had a three daughters. One day daughters were kidnapping by a dark cloud. The king said that person who will save princesses should have one of them to wife, and should, after his death, reign in his stead.
